Surrey Level 2 devolution framework agreement

Proposed agreement for a Level 2 devolution framework agreement between the government and Surrey County Council.

This agreement marks an important step for devolution in Surrey by giving local leaders more control and influence over the levers of local growth. The agreement transfers new powers and funding to Surrey County Council, including devolution of the adult education budget.

This agreement is subject to ratification by Surrey County Council, and to the statutory requirements for making the secondary legislation implementing the provisions of the agreement. These statutory requirements include those councils consenting to the legislation and Parliament approving it. Once that legislation is made the agreement will be confirmed.
